Output 76a4e16cf4f0e018c6610e32a000b23a1356019af265f21a14d374588e7dcd83:0

value
10343440000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34712990cfd2947a67cbe16efdba88c2bcb17c89 OP_EQUALVERIFY OP_CHECKSIG
address
15nHhdnUHRaZPcLhzfP9CLpq6ZpVkuphNg
transaction
76a4e16cf4f0e018c6610e32a000b23a1356019af265f21a14d374588e7dcd83
spent
true